Nicola Uccello 1874 - 1967

Nicola Uccello of Struthers, Mahoning County, Ohio was born on December 6, 1874, and died at age 92 years old in June 1967.

In 1874, in the year that Nicola Uccello was born, on September 14th, the Battle of Liberty Place occurred in New Orleans - the capital of Louisiana. Some members of the previous Confederate Army assembled for the purpose of "driving the usurpers from power" and the Republican Governor - William P. Kellogg - was physically driven from his office. The former Confederates temporarily replaced him with (the former) Democratic Governor John McEnery. Federal forces arrived, put down the insurrection, and five days later the legally elected government was restored.
